Nouakchott (INA) – The Mauritanian government decided, Thursday, to raise customs duties on imported rice and petroleum derivatives, according to Finance Minister Mokhtar Ould Ajay. Commenting on the results of the cabinet meeting, the minister said that the local production of rice covers 75 percent of the local needs of this substance, adding that raising these fees comes within the framework of the government's efforts to search for reserve resources to cover its expenses.
